What Is Amylase Enzyme?
Starch Hydrolysis
Amylase cleaves alpha-1,4-glycosidic bonds in starch molecules, converting them into dextrins, maltose, and glucose for use in sweetener production, fermentation, and food processing.
Thermostable Variants
Our thermostable alpha-amylase operates at 85-110\u00b0C, ideal for jet cooking in starch liquefaction. Lower-temperature variants available for baking and brewing applications.

Amylase Applications & Industries
Starch & Sweetener Production
Starch liquefaction and saccharification for production of glucose syrup, high-fructose corn syrup (HFCS), maltodextrin, and other starch-derived sweeteners.
Baking & Flour Treatment
Improves bread volume, crust color, and shelf life by generating fermentable sugars and modifying starch during dough processing and baking.
Brewing & Distilling
Converts grain starch into fermentable sugars during mashing. Alpha-amylase for liquefaction, glucoamylase for saccharification, and beta-amylase for maltose production.
Textile Desizing
Removes starch-based sizing agents from woven fabrics before dyeing. Enzymatic desizing is faster, gentler, and more environmentally friendly than chemical methods.
